Implementation of Variative Methods Based on a Scientific Approach to Improve the Understanding of Islamic Jurisprudence in Elementary Madrasah Students
Main Article Content
Abstract
This study aims to describe the implementation of a variety of methods based on a scientific approach to improve students' understanding of Islamic jurisprudence (fiqh) at Nurul Hidayah Roworejo Elementary School. The study used a qualitative approach with data collection techniques through interviews and observations. The research respondents consisted of Islamic jurisprudence teachers and the principal of the school. The results showed that teachers implemented various methods, such as lectures, questions and answers, discussions, and demonstrations, combined with the steps of the scientific approach, namely observing, asking, exploring, associating, and communicating. However, several obstacles were found, including limited reading materials and learning media, teachers' suboptimal understanding of the scientific approach, and a lack of support for facilities and infrastructure. Improvement efforts were made through increasing teacher creativity in developing learning media, searching for alternative learning resources, and expanding discussion spaces with students. In addition, support from the principal in providing facilities and training is essential to improve the effectiveness of curriculum implementation. This study recommends synergy between teachers and schools to strengthen the quality of Islamic jurisprudence learning at the Elementary School.
